Specifically with Hellenism, libations are easy and can very well be secretive. We use them a lot. Simply pouring out a cup of water is a lovely offering. Perhaps you can pour a cup out into the bathroom sink after brushing your teeth, or maybe pouring a cup outside (although that may be more obvious).
